What should I look for when choosing tires for my Vauxhall Mokka?

I am looking to replace my tires on my Vauxhall Mokka and want to make sure I am getting the best option for my vehicle. What factors should I consider when choosing tires for my car? Are there any specific brands or models that you recommend?

When choosing tires for your Vauxhall Mokka, there are a few key factors to consider. First, make sure to check the size and load rating of the tires to ensure they are compatible with your vehicle. Additionally, consider the type of driving you do and the weather conditions in your region, as certain tires may be better suited for wet or snowy roads. As for specific brands or models, it ultimately depends on your personal preference and budget, but some popular options for the Vauxhall Mokka include Goodyear, Michelin, and Continental. I recommend doing some research and reading reviews to find the best tires for your specific needs.

In addition to considering size and load rating, take a look at the tread pattern and depth. This can affect your car's handling and traction, especially in wet or slippery conditions. It's also worth considering the tire's durability and tread life warranty. Some brands may offer longer warranties than others, which can save you money in the long run. As for a specific recommendation, I personally have had good experiences with Pirelli tires on my Vauxhall Mokka. But again, be sure to do some research and compare options to find the best fit for your vehicle.
